Beaches
As you would expect from an island with magnificent sunshine the beaches in Porto Vecchio are always bustling. There are numerous beaches in the Porto Vecchio area including the famous white sand Palombaggia Beach. With its turquoise blue waters and shady pine trees Palombaggia is hard to beat but you can also try out the popular Santa Giulia and Roccapina beaches.
 
Water Sports
Water sports are a popular daytime activity in Porto Vecchio and diving, wind surfing, jet skiing and water skiing are all available. Holiday makers can also hire motor boats and drift along the coastline at their leisure.
 
Eating Out
There is a wealth of fabulous restaurants in Porto Vecchio and French cuisine is just one of the many dining options available. The seafood is second to none, not to mention the local Corsican wine. International restaurants are in abundance and the prices are very reasonable for the mouth watering dishes you will receive.
 
Boat Excursions
A very popular day out can be had on some of the exciting boat excursions from Porto Vecchio. Trips to the nearby Lavezzi Isles nature reserve should not be missed, and you can take in the lovely beaches while there. The Marine Cemetery and Aquarium de Bonifacio are also well worth a trip.
 
Land Sports
If you like your holidays a little more energetic then there are numerous land sports available in Porto Vecchio. You can try your hand at golf, mountain biking, bungee jumping, quad biking and hiking in the spectacular l’Opesdale Forest.

Nightlife
Porto Vecchio is known for its sophisticated and vibrant nightlife. The bars, clubs and restaurants around the marina area are always lively and they do become the social focus once the evening arrives. The weather is also perfect for long cool drinks on the open air terraces in the town square.
